Deep Sea Fishing in Santa Rosa Beach
- Conditions
- Info
Ideal Conditions:
Calm seas with low wind (under 15 knots), clear skies, and stable weather fronts provide ideal fishing conditions. Water temperatures ranging from 72°F to 85°F generally correspond with abundant fish activity offshore.
Moon Phase:
Fishing tends to improve around new and full moons due to tidal shifts increasing fish feeding activity.
Best Period:
Prime deep sea fishing season is from late spring through early fall, particularly May to September, when water temperatures are warmer and fish are most active.
License:
A valid Florida Saltwater Fishing License is required for anglers aged 16 and older. Many charter operators include licensing options as part of their packages.
